site stats

How to take modulus in assembly language

WebMay 7, 2005 · Unlike the other decimal/ASCII adjust instructions, assembly language programs regularly use aam since conversion between number bases uses this algorithm. … Web• Machine language and Assembly language are both –Microprocessor specific (Machine dependent) so they are called –Low-level languages • Machine independent languages are called –High-level languages –For e.g. BASIC, PASCAL,C++,C,JAVA, etc. –A software called Compiler is required to convert a high-level language program to machine ...

Learn Risc-V Assembly Programming - RISC-V International

WebNov 19, 2006 · I am programming on the Intel IXP platform in microcode, and need to get the modulo of two numbers but can't quite figure this one out. They have given a divide() macro to simplify a division operation, but nothing for getting a remainder. WebJul 11, 2024 · Program to find remainder without using modulo or % operator. Given two numbers ‘num’ and ‘divisor’, find remainder when ‘num’ is divided by ‘divisor’. The use of modulo or % operator is not allowed. Input: num = 100, divisor = 7 Output: 2 Input: num = 30, divisor = 9 Output: 3. Recommended: Please try your approach on {IDE ... rayburn correctional facility angie la https://familysafesolutions.com

How to calculate a Modulo? - Mathematics Stack Exchange

WebThe time quantum T for RR should be larger than the average CPU demand between two I/O operations (CPU burst) of 80% of the processes. Scheduling Methods: Select all of the following statements that are true. A service time of a process can be estimated by applying the method of exponential averaging. Shortest Job First (SJF) is a preemptive ... WebNov 22, 2007 · The remaining numerator will be the modulus. Try doing it in a high level lanquage first, then do it in assembly. BTW, many micros that have an integer divide will … WebMar 27, 2024 · It’s important you know them off hand. Take a second to go back and read the section on general purpose registers, and then come back. — Microcode versus Assembly. A common problem when reading reference material for assembly and low-level development is the misuse of terms. Particularly, the terms microcode and machine code. … rayburn country association map

How to write modulus (% in C++) in assembly language

Category:Assembly Language Programming Tutorial - 38 - TEST Instruction

Tags:How to take modulus in assembly language

How to take modulus in assembly language

Learn Risc-V Assembly Programming - RISC-V International

WebNov 19, 2006 · I am programming on the Intel IXP platform in microcode, and need to get the modulo of two numbers but can't quite figure this one out. They have given a divide() … WebJan 26, 2024 · Learn Risc-V Assembly Programming – Lesson1 : For absolute beginners! ChibiAkumas By RISC-V Community News January 26, 2024 January 28th, 2024 No Comments This is the first in a series of tutorials which will teach you how to get started with RiscV (Risc 5) programming This tutorial assumes you have no previous experience …

How to take modulus in assembly language

Did you know?

Weba) write a linear model for this question. takeoff and landing will take a fixed amount of time. actual travel in the air will take time proportional to the distance traveled. identify the slope and intercept with their units. b) use the data in the quotation to estimate the two constants in your linear model. http://i-programmer.info/babbages-bag/481-the-mod-function.html

WebMar 2, 2024 · Therefore, in C/C++ language we always find remainder as (a%b + b)%b (add quotient to remainder and again take remainder) to avoid negative remainder. Anyone can predict the output of a modulus operator when both operands are positive. But when it comes to the negative numbers, different languages give different outputs. Webx86 Assembly Guide. This is a version adapted by Quentin Carbonneaux from David Evans' original document. The syntax was changed from Intel to AT&T, the standard syntax on …

WebApr 23, 2024 · A look at signed and unsigned integer multiplication, division, and modulus operations.Bradley Sward is currently an Associate Professor at the College of Du... Webx86 Assembly Guide. This is a version adapted by Quentin Carbonneaux from David Evans' original document. The syntax was changed from Intel to AT&T, the standard syntax on UNIX systems, and the HTML code was purified. This guide describes the basics of 32-bit x86 assembly language programming, covering a small but useful subset of the available ...

WebFeb 1, 2024 · abs(), labs(), llabs() functions are defined in cstdlib header file. These functions return the absolute value of integer that is input to them as their argument. abs() function: Input to this function is value of type int in C and value of type int, long int or long long int in C++. In C output is of int type and in C++ the output has same data type as input.

WebTake some tips from us and learn How to do modulus in assembly. ... Solved In LC3 Assembly Language write a program Given two. MOD Assembler Operator Description. … simple report program in sap abapWebFeb 25, 2024 · This says that the least significant n bits of k plus the remaining bits of k are equivalent to k modulo $2^n−1$. This equivalence can be used repeatedly until at most n bits remain. In this way, the remainder after dividing k by the Mersenne number $2^n−1$ is computed without using division. I am having difficulty understanding what this ... simplereports.gov/app/sign-upWebThe mod (x,y) function, or the mod operator x % y in Python, C# or JavaScript say, is very simple but you can think about it at least two different ways - corresponding, roughly speaking, to passive and active models of what is going on. First the passive: The most obvious definition is: mod (x,y) or x % y gives the remainder when you. simple reports shareWebWe can take a shortcut by observing that every 7 steps we end up in the same position on the modular circle. These complete loops around the modular circle don’t contribute to our final position.We ignore these complete loops around the circle by calculating each number mod 7 (as shown in the two upper modular circles). This will give us the number of … rayburn country clubWebMay 13, 2024 · In x86 assembly (and in any other assembly for that matter) you can very easily calculate the remainder of a division by a power of two without having to use a … simplereport statesWeb3.5.2 Remainder operator, even/odd number checker. The following is the MIPS implementation of the even/odd checker. To find the remainder the div operator is used to divide by 2 and the remainder retrieved from the hi register. If the remainder is 0 the number is even, and 1 if it is odd. simple report sheetWebNov 22, 2013 · In assembly languages that don't have a bit test instruction, you will have to (Boolean) AND the value with 1: LODI, R0 #5 ; Load register 0 with the number 5. ANDI, R0 … rayburn country club brookeland tx